The function WORKDAY in help pages and also its implementation has only the
first 3 parameters whereas ODF section has 4 parameters. Also ODF mentions
passing {0;0;0;0;0;1;1} or {1;0;0;0;0;0;1}  or even this {0;0;0;1;1;1;1} as
the Holiday parameter which when I tried does not change the result.

I have stated that "Calc's implementation of WORKDAY function is not
strictly in accordance with ODF 1.2." in wiki.

Calc's function works just like MS Excel's function does.

> I could sense an error on the help pages for BETA.INV and BETAINV
> function. The definition of Number is wrong. It states Number to be between
> Start and End but actually it is the probability which is associated with
> BETA function for other given arguments and the output will be that Number.
>
> Compare it with MS excel equivalent
> https://support.microsoft.com/en-us/office/beta-inv-function-e84cb8aa-8df0-4cf6-9892-83a341d252eb
> .
>
> Actually out function works the same way but the description of this
> Number is wrong.
>
> One eg to prove the point is : =BETA.INV(0.5,3,4,3,4) gives
> 3.42140719069071
>
> But =BETA.INV(3.5,3,4,3,4) gives Err:502 which infact qualifies the
> definition.
